2. Velocity limitations
Velocity limitations are a critical aspect governing the use and legality of airsoft devices. Regulations surrounding projectile velocity are designed to minimize the risk of injury during recreational and training activities. The specific velocity limitations often dictate the permissible usage environments and impact the realism of the simulation.
- Field and Arena Regulations
Airsoft fields and arenas typically impose strict velocity limits, often measured in feet per second (FPS) using 0.20g BBs. These limits vary depending on the venue and the type of gameplay. Exceeding these velocity limits can result in disqualification from play and potential liability for injuries. Chronographs are commonly used to measure the FPS of airsoft devices before gameplay to ensure compliance.
- Jurisdictional Legal Restrictions
In addition to field-specific rules, local and national laws may impose maximum velocity limits for airsoft devices. These laws are intended to regulate the potential for injury and misuse. Violating these legal restrictions can result in fines, confiscation of the device, or even criminal charges. Compliance with jurisdictional laws is essential for responsible ownership and operation.

3. Protective eyewear
The operation of devices replicating firearms necessitates the consistent use of appropriate protective eyewear. These devices, while firing non-lethal projectiles, propel them at velocities capable of causing serious eye injury. The absence of adequate eye protection during operation introduces a significant risk of corneal abrasion, retinal detachment, and permanent vision loss. This underscores protective eyewear as an indispensable component of any responsible usage scenario. For instance, a stray projectile impacting an unprotected eye during target practice can result in immediate and irreversible damage. This is neither theoretical nor trivial, and underscores the practical significance of understanding the necessity of protection.
Eyewear designed for this application must meet specific standards, such as ANSI Z87.1 certification, to ensure sufficient impact resistance. Standard eyeglasses or sunglasses typically do not provide adequate protection against the velocities and projectile types used in airsoft activities. Furthermore, eyewear should fit securely to prevent projectiles from entering around the frames. Full-seal goggles offer a superior level of protection compared to open-frame glasses. Tactical simulations, for example, frequently incorporate mandatory eyewear checks to enforce safety protocols and minimize potential injuries.

4. Maintenance Schedule
Consistent adherence to a structured maintenance schedule is paramount for preserving the operational integrity and extending the lifespan of any airsoft device, including those replicating models from established firearms manufacturers. Neglecting routine maintenance can result in diminished performance, increased risk of malfunctions, and accelerated component degradation.
- Lubrication of Internal Components
Regular lubrication of gears, pistons, and other moving parts within the gearbox assembly is crucial for minimizing friction and wear. The type of lubricant used must be compatible with the materials used in the device’s construction. Silicone-based lubricants are commonly recommended, while petroleum-based products may damage certain components. Inadequate lubrication can lead to increased stress on parts, resulting in premature failure and reduced firing rate. For example, a piston head operating without adequate lubrication can wear down rapidly, reducing compression and power output.
- Cleaning of Barrel and Hop-Up Unit
The internal barrel and hop-up unit are responsible for the accuracy and range of the replica. The accumulation of dirt, dust, and BB residue within the barrel can impede projectile trajectory and reduce accuracy. Similarly, contamination of the hop-up bucking can affect its ability to impart backspin to the BB, impacting range and consistency. Regular cleaning with a dedicated cleaning rod and appropriate solvents is essential for maintaining optimal performance. A dirty hop-up unit, for instance, may cause erratic BB flight patterns and decreased effective range.
- Inspection and Replacement of O-Rings and Seals
O-rings and seals are critical for maintaining air compression within the airsoft device. Over time, these components can degrade due to wear, heat, and exposure to lubricants. Leaking o-rings can result in significant power loss and inconsistent firing. Regular inspection of o-rings and seals for cracks, tears, or deformation is necessary, and replacement should occur as needed. The failure of a piston o-ring, for example, can dramatically reduce the replica’s FPS and effective range.
- Gearbox Shim Adjustment and Inspection
Proper gear meshing within the gearbox is essential for efficient power transfer and minimizing stress on the gears. Incorrect shimming can lead to excessive noise, increased wear, and potential gear breakage. Regular inspection of the gearbox shimming and adjustment as needed is crucial for maintaining smooth and reliable operation. Poorly shimmed gears can generate excessive heat and friction, leading to premature wear and potential gearbox failure.

5. Local ordinances
The legal landscape surrounding the use and ownership of items replicating actual firearms, specifically including those produced under license from established manufacturers, is significantly influenced by the specific regulations in force at the local level. Understanding these ordinances is crucial for responsible ownership and lawful usage. Failure to comply can result in legal penalties and potential confiscation of the device.
- Definition of “Toy” vs. “Replica Firearm”
Local ordinances frequently delineate between items classified as toys and those categorized as replica firearms. The criteria often include factors such as color, size, construction materials, and the presence of markings resembling actual firearms. Items deemed replica firearms may be subject to stricter regulations than those classified as toys. For example, an ordinance might require that replica firearms be stored in locked containers when not in use, while toys are not subject to the same requirement.
- Permissible Usage Locations
Many local ordinances restrict the locations where devices simulating firearms can be used. Discharging these devices in public parks, streets, or other unauthorized areas may be prohibited. Some ordinances may permit usage only on private property with the express permission of the property owner. Furthermore, the discharge of such a device in a manner that causes alarm or fear among the public may constitute a violation of local laws. For instance, an ordinance might explicitly prohibit aiming a replica firearm at another person, even if the device is unloaded.
- Transportation and Display Restrictions
Local ordinances may impose restrictions on the transportation and public display of replica firearms. These restrictions are intended to prevent alarming the public and minimizing the risk of misidentification by law enforcement. Ordinances may require that replica firearms be transported in closed containers or bags, and may prohibit displaying them in a manner that is visible to the public. A common example is a requirement to transport a replica firearm in the trunk of a vehicle, rather than in the passenger compartment.
- Age Restrictions and Parental Responsibility
Some local ordinances establish minimum age requirements for owning or using replica firearms. These ordinances often place a responsibility on parents or guardians to supervise the use of such devices by minors. Violations of age restriction ordinances may result in fines or other penalties for both the minor and the responsible adult. An example would be an ordinance prohibiting anyone under the age of 16 from possessing a replica firearm without adult supervision.

Question 3: What is the typical effective range of replica firearms?
Effective range is contingent upon various factors, including power source (electric, gas, spring), projectile weight, and hop-up system. Generally, effective ranges extend from 50 to 200 feet. Upgrades and modifications can potentially increase range, but may also affect legality and reliability.
